建立和管理 UII 託管應用程式
發行︰ 2016年11月
適用於: Dynamics 365 (online)、Dynamics 365 (on-premises)、Dynamics CRM 2013、Dynamics CRM 2015、Dynamics CRM 2016
User Interface Integration (UII) 託管應用程式讓您在Unified Service Desk中建立和託管 UII 託管控制項、Windows Forms 或 Windows Presentation Foundation (WPF) 應用程式、Web 應用程式或遠端 (Citrix) 應用程式。
在此主題,您將了解如何在Unified Service Desk中設定 UII 託管應用程式。
建立託管應用程式
登入 Microsoft Dynamics 365。
按一下或點選導覽列上的 [Microsoft Dynamics 365],然後選取 [設定]。
選擇 [設定] > [Unified Service Desk] > [託管控制項]。
選擇 [新增]。
在 [新增託管控制項] 頁面的 [一般] 區域下,指定名稱、排序順序及顯示託管應用程式的名稱。 每個託管應用程式必須有唯一的名稱。 排序順序指定 [Unified Service Desk] 中擷取及顯示託管應用程式的順序。 在 [負責人] 方塊中,選取負責人。
在 [Unified Service Desk] 區域中,從 [USD 元件類型] 清單選取 [CCA 託管應用程式]。 [新增託管控制項] 頁面中的欄位根據您所選擇的託管控制項型別而變更。 如需各種託管控制項類型的詳細資訊,請參閱 託管控制項型別和動作/事件參考
在 [託管應用程式類型] 區域中,選取託管應用程式類型。 [代管服務] 區域中的欄位根據您所選取的託管應用程式類型而變更。
如果是託管控制項,選取 [託管控制項] 類型。 在 [代管服務] 區域中,指定組件 URI 和類型。
[URI] 是您的組件名稱,而 [類型] 是您的組件 (dll) 的名稱後面接著句點 (.), 最後是您的 Visual Studio 專案中的類別名稱。
若要託管 Web 應用程式,請選取 [Web 託管應用程式] 類型。 在 [代管服務] 區域中,
[應用程式代管] 用來指定託管應用程式的模式。 有三個託管應用程式的模式,如下,
外部代管 – 允許應用程式在 [Unified Service Desk] 外啟動
使用 SetParent – 設定應用程式根視窗為 [Unified Service Desk] 子視窗。
使用動態定位 – 監控 [Unified Service Desk] 應用程式的大小和位置,以及動態調整應用程式的大小和位置。
在 [Web 應用程式首頁] 中,
URL - 指定應用程式執行的 URL。
使用工具列 – 已核取時顯示 Internet Explorer 工具列。
使用新的瀏覽器處理序 – 已核取時,在新 Internet Explorer 處理序中啟動應用程式。
管理快顯畫面 – 已核取時,允許在 [Unified Service Desk] 管理快顯視窗。
如需有關如何在 [Unified Service Desk] 建置和託管 Web 應用程式的詳細資訊,請參閱逐步解說:建立 UII Web 應用程式配接器的步驟 1 到 3。
若要託管外部應用程式,請選取 [外部託管應用程式] 類型。 在 [代管服務] 區域中,
在 [外部應用程式設定] 區域中,
外部應用程式 URI – 指定可執行檔的路徑。
引數 – 指定在應用程式啟動時使用的引數。
工作目錄 – 指定可執行檔的工作目錄。
管理代管服務 – 允許在 [Unified Service Desk] 管理代管服務。
在 [應用程式代管] 中,
應用程式代管 - 和上面 8a 相同。
無訊息幫浦 – 指定應用程式是否有 Windows 訊息佇列。
顯示功能表 – 已核取時,顯示系統功能表應用程式。
主視窗取得逾時 – 指定可以找到最上層視窗控制代碼的逾時期限。
如需有關如何在 [Unified Service Desk] 建置和託管外部應用程式的詳細資訊,請參閱逐步解說:建立 UII 應用程式配接器的步驟 1 到 3。
如果是代管 Citrix 應用程式,請選取 [遠端託管應用程式] 類型。其他資訊:整合 Citrix 應用程式
在 [通用屬性] 區域中,
已核取 [應用程式是全域的] 時,應用程式全域執行並獨立於工作階段內容之外。
[顯示群組] 指定應用程式在 [Unified Service Desk] 託管的位置。 例如,[MainPanel] 或 [WorkflowPanel]。
已核取 [依存於工作流程] 時,應用程式只透過工作流程步驟載入。
[大小下限 X] 指定在 [Unified Service Desk] 中應用程式視窗的大小下限 (沿著 X 軸)。
[大小下限 Y] 指定在 [Unified Service Desk] 中應用程式視窗的大小下限 (沿著 Y 軸)。
[最佳大小 X] 指定在 [Unified Service Desk] 中應用程式視窗的顯示大小 (沿著 X 軸)。
[最佳大小 Y] 指定在 [Unified Service Desk] 中應用程式視窗的顯示大小 (沿著 Y 軸)。
在 [動態] 區域,已核取 [應用程式是動態的] 時,表示應用程式可以動態載入,而且 [使用者可關閉] 和 [顯示在工具列下拉式清單中] 核取方塊會變成啟用。
在 [配接器設定] 區段,有三個配接器設定可從 [配接器] 下拉式清單中選取:
不使用配接器 – 指定託管應用程式不需要任何自動化。
使用自動化配接器 (HAT) – 指定用於託管應用工具套件 (HAT) 軟體工廠的預設設定。
使用配接器 – 指定託管應用程式使用自訂的配接器。
若要了解如何建立和設定外部應用程式配接器,請參閱逐步解說:建立 UII 應用程式配接器的步驟 4 到 6。
若要了解如何建立和設定 Web 應用程式配接器,請參閱逐步解說:建立 UII Web 應用程式配接器的步驟 4 到 6。
如果託管應用程式使用自動化配接器 (HAT),[自動化] 區段的 [自動化 XML] 包含託管應用程式的繫結資訊。 如需繫結的詳細資訊,請參閱使用 UII 檢查器建立其他託管應用程式的繫結。
在 [擴充功能] 區段中,指定託管控制項的其他設定資訊。 如需擴充功能 XML 設定範例,請參閱 Kpi 託管控制項定義。 Kpi 託管控制項是 [Unified Service Desk] 隨附的範例應用程式之一。
按一下 [儲存] 建立託管應用程式。
另請參閱
與外部應用程式與 Web 應用程式整合
整合 Citrix 應用程式
Unified Service Desk 2.0
© 2017 Microsoft. 著作權所有,並保留一切權利。 著作權